18/7/07

Back was crap so no squats:

Bench Press
60x3, 80x3, 100x3, 115x3, 125x1, 132.5x1, 140x1, 140x1 PB, 142.5x??

It was supposed to be 132.5 for singles but the first was so easy I decided to go for a PB. Made the foolish error on 140 of telling the spotter that (unlike on 132.5 where I just needed a hand-off), I "might" need help on this rep. As I ought to have known, to him this meant "Please lift it with me." He didn't do much but when I asked "did you help?" he said "No, just my fingers on the bar". So he helped. So I had to take 140 again, was very precise in my instructions and got it without much trouble. Should have been just as insistent on the 142.5, because just as the bar slowed down the t**t yanked it clean off me. It was hard, but I'd got past my usual sticking point and I felt I was going to get it.

Machine Row
127.5x12x3

Pulldown (supinated)
105x12x2
